                                              While I can't comment on any of these specific doctors, I would recommend that you have a consultation with all of them if your insurance and schedule permit it.  Book the appointments and visit each on to hear their advice and treatment approach and decide after you've met with all of them which one to continue with.  This is no small matter and its important to work with someone you are comfortable with.  I "interviewed" three specialists and had three different treatment paths recommended to me.  One wanted to do surgery followed by watch and wait.  Another wanted to submit me to a clinical trial he was working on and the third wanted to start me on Ipi and use the existing mets to measure progress.

                                                          I don't know Dr Flagerty but can share my experience with Wolchok. I have been treated by Dr Wolchok at MSK in NYC since early summer of 2011. I find the MSK office staff extremely efficient in scheduling appointments which is important for me as I travel in from upstate NY for treatment. Dr Wolchok and his entire staff of fellows, PA's and nurses are top shelf. Caring, articulate and importantly very up to speed on the latest treatments. The MSK web message portal is very effective for messaging and reviewing labs, radiation and consult visit results as well. When I have called his office with a specific treatment question I have always gotten a call back from a knowledgable medical staff member or the doctor. I fell blessed to be under Dr Wolchoks care and feel that my survival to date  is reflective of the skill of the Dr and the MSK team. I am always horrified  when I see the amount of people with cancer in that waiting room but they move people along at the right pace and I feel that I have exactly the right amount of time with the doctor and his staff.
